Eagles win Lions Club Buckaroo Shootout

Body
The Holliday Eagles travelled south to compete in the Lions Club Buckaroo Shootout basketball tournament in Breckenridge from Thursday, Dec. 5 to Saturday, Dec. 7. The Eagles swept the competition in the tournament, finished with a 4-0 record, and secured the tournament championship.

Windthorst, Archer City compete in Wi ldcat Classic

Body
The both the Girls’ and Boys’ varsity basketball teams for Archer City and Windthorst competed in the annual Wildcat Classic Tournament in Archer City from Thursday, Dec. 5 to Saturday, Dec. 7. Both the Trojans and the Wildcats finished with a 1-4 record, while the Lady Cats and the Trojanettes posted a tournament record of 2-2.

Dispute muddies water tower contract

Body
The Holliday City Council motioned to allow Mayor Brad Litteken to serve AO Industrial Solutions a notice of default of their contract after failure to complete the rehabilitation and painting of an elevated storage tank and associated work in their city council meeting on Monday, Dec. 9.

Lindley Headlines ACN Super 10

Body
The 24-25 volleyball season featured a lot of young talent itching to make names for themselves, as well as stalwart upperclassmen looking to lay it on the line for one final year. The Archer City Lady Cats’ playoff streak continued, the Holliday Lady Eagles soared through their playoff competition for a Regional Finals round appearance, and the Windthorst Trojanettes overcame so many odds to battle to the State Semifinals round for the 25th time in school history.
Windthorst's Megg Lindley earned Archer County News Super 10 MVP honors after she placed top five in the county in kills, blocks, digs and assists as she led the Trojanettes to the State Semifinals. Photo/Landon Davis
